Fatigue in the driver

The majority of accidents in trucks are caused by fatigued drivers. It can have severe consequences. It's the same similar to driving under the influence and can affect the driver's ability to judge and to concentrate. Driver fatigue can lead to permanent brain injuries, fractured bones and even death in accidents involving trucks.

Everyone is affected by fatigue in a different way. There is no "right" amount. Even truck drivers who follow recommended sleep hours may still be tired. Driver fatigue can lead to serious accidents involving trucks. Truck drivers should be proactive to avoid getting tired at the wheel. This article will highlight the warning signs and ways to avoid becoming a victim of this dangerous scenario.

Fatigued driving is a complex problem, and it requires investigation. An attorney who is experienced in cases involving trucking accidents can utilize a variety of methods to determine who is accountable for a trucker's fatigue-related collision. In addition to examining electronic driver logs and communications with the trucking company they can also look over prior violations, circumstantial evidence and the actions taken prior the accident.

Driver fatigue is a major cause of impairment to many crucial functions of the human brain, including vision as well as reaction time, judgment and coordination. The consequences of this impairment could cause collisions between head and body or a side-swipe accident. FMCSA has strict Hours of Service regulations to address driver fatigue. Trucking accidents caused by driver fatigue could result in negligence on part of a trucking company.

Research on fatigued truck drivers has found that up to 40% of fatal truck accidents involve drivers who are fatigued. The causes and occurrence of fatigued driving can differ from one accident to the next however it is clear that fatigued driving has a significant impact on a truck driver's safety. According to the Safety Board, fatigue is responsible for 30-40% of all accidents involving large trucks.

Truck drivers and other drivers can be affected by the effects of fatigue. Tired truck drivers may make poor decisions, slow their reactions and could even be asleep behind the wheel. This makes it difficult to avoid collisions and difficult maneuvers.

Hazardous cargo

Most accidents on trucks are caused by hazardous cargo. These cargoes should be handled with extra care and consideration for safety. Federal regulations require that drivers undergo special training to be able to safely transport dangerous materials. Companies operating trucks must also comply with additional rules. Accidents involving hazardous cargo may result in injury or even death.

The cargo can contain toxic chemicals or other substances that pose a threat to humans or the environment. These chemicals can leach into groundwater and cause health problems for people who live nearby. Explosives can also trigger deadly levels of smoke, heat or fire. These include rocket motors, black powder, and fireworks.

Truck accidents involving HAZMAT cargo are particularly dangerous due to the fact that the cargo can be extremely corrosive, and pose a major danger to passengers, drivers as well as the environment and everyone involved. Toxic fumes, as well as other hazardous substances can trigger immediate health problems for everyone who is exposed. Contaminated groundwater poses health hazards for a long period of time.

Tanker trucks transporting chemicals may cause a vehicle to tip over and alter its balance. These substances can also ignite with the tiniest spark.
